Cost of Memory Care in the Athens, GA area
ATHENS memory care homes take the #10 spot for lowest memory care cost out of 336 cities that we've reviewed in Georgia. The average cost of a dementia or Alzheimer's care facility in ATHENS, GA is $3,936 per month. The cheapest memory care homes for Alzheimer’s and dementia have average monthly fees of $2,282, while the more expensive and luxury memory care homes in ATHENS could charge up to $6,823 per month. When compared to CLARKE county, which has an average monthly cost of $4,017, ATHENS, GA memory care facilities are more affordable. Senior citizens and their families can expect to pay $972 less yearly for memory care in ATHENS when compared to CLARKE county. Moreover, ATHENS dementia care is $6,720 per year less as compared to memory care communities located in other parts of Georgia, which have an aggregate average cost of $4,496 per month.

Frequently Asked Questions About Memory Care Facilities in Athens, Georgia
What services are typically offered at memory care facilities in Athens, Georgia?
Memory care facilities in Athens, Georgia, typically offer a wide range of specialized services tailored to individuals with Alzheimer's disease, dementia, and other cognitive impairments. These services may include 24/7 supervision and care by trained professionals, personalized care plans, and assistance with activities of daily living (ADLs) such as bathing, dressing, and grooming. Additionally, memory care facilities may often provide secure environments to prevent wandering, cognitive therapies to slow the progression of memory loss, medication management, and structured activities designed to promote cognitive function and social engagement. Facilities may also offer amenities such as nutritious meals, housekeeping, laundry services, transportation, and access to on-site medical care or physical therapy.
How do memory care facilities ensure the safety of their residents?
Memory care facilities often implement several safety measures to protect their residents. These may include secured entryways and exits to prevent residents from wandering off, which is a common concern in individuals with dementia. Many facilities are designed with a layout that minimizes confusion and reduces the risk of falls, such as circular hallways and open common areas. Additionally, residents are often equipped with wearable devices that allow staff to monitor their location and wellbeing. Emergency response systems should be in place, with staff trained to handle crises such as medical emergencies or behavioral issues promptly. Regular safety drills and staff training sessions should further ensure that all team members are prepared to provide a secure environment for residents.

Are there any specialized memory care programs available in Athens, Georgia, that focus on specific stages of dementia?
Some memory care facilities in Athens, Georgia may offer specialized programs tailored to specific stages of dementia. These programs are designed to meet the unique needs of individuals at different levels of cognitive decline, providing appropriate care and activities that cater to their current abilities. Early-stage programs often focus on maintaining cognitive function and independence through activities that stimulate the brain, such as memory exercises, puzzles, and social engagement. As dementia progresses, mid-stage programs may emphasize structured routines, physical activities, and emotional support to help residents navigate daily challenges. For those in the later stages of dementia, memory care facilities may offer more intensive care with a focus on comfort, safety, and quality of life, including sensory stimulation therapies and personalized care plans. Families should inquire about the specific programs offered at each facility and how they adapt to the changing needs of residents as their condition evolves.
